The Importance of an Emergency Car Locksmith
An emergency situation car locksmith is a customized professional trained to handle a large variety of automotive lock concerns quickly and efficiently. These professionals are equipped with the current tools and techniques to unlock your car, duplicate keys, and even program key fobs, all without causing damage to your vehicle. In scenarios where you might be stranded, an emergency situation car locksmith can be a lifesaver, ensuring you return on the road as quickly as possible.
Typical Reasons for Calling an Emergency Car Locksmith
Locked Keys Inside the Car
This is among the most typical factors individuals discover themselves in requirement of an emergency car locksmith. It's simple to lock your keys in the car, particularly if you're in a hurry or distracted.
Lost or Stolen Car Keys
Losing or having your car keys stolen can be a considerable inconvenience and a security danger. An emergency situation car locksmith can supply instant support to protect your vehicle and replace the lost or stolen keys.
Key Fob Malfunction
Modern cars and trucks frequently come with key fobs that can malfunction due to battery issues, water damage, or general wear and tear. A locksmith can diagnose the issue and provide an option, consisting of reprogramming or changing the fob.
Broken Lock Cylinder
In time, the lock cylinder in your car can break or break. An emergency car locksmith can repair or replace the cylinder, guaranteeing your car remains secure.
Frozen Locks

Initial Contact
When you call an emergency situation car locksmith, you'll likely speak with a dispatcher who will collect fundamental information about your circumstance, such as your area, the kind of car, and the particular issue you're dealing with.
Dispatch and Arrival Time
The dispatcher will dispatch a locksmith to your place. The majority of reliable services objective to get here within 30 minutes to an hour. Nevertheless, wait times can vary depending upon the demand and the locksmith's availability.
Assessment and Service
Once the locksmith arrives, they will assess the situation and provide you with an estimate of the cost and time required to fix the issue. They will then use their specialized tools to unlock your car, replicate keys, or repair the lock.
Payment and Documentation
After the service is finished, the locksmith will provide you with an in-depth billing. Payment methods can differ, however most locksmiths accept money, charge card, and digital payments. Q: How much does an emergency situation car locksmith service cost?
A: The cost can vary depending upon the service required, the area, and the time of day. Usually, you can expect to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for an emergency situation unlock. More intricate services, such as key duplication or lock replacement, may cost more.
Q: Can an emergency car locksmith help if my key fob is dead?
A: Yes, many emergency car locksmith professionals are geared up to deal with key fob problems. They can replace the battery, reprogram the fob, and even replace the whole fob if essential.

Q: Is it legal for an emergency situation car locksmith to open my car without a key?
A: Yes, it is legal for a certified and bonded emergency situation car locksmith to open your car without a key. Nevertheless, they might require you to offer proof of ownership, such as a motorist's license or a vehicle registration.
